2012-01-18 21:53:01 +01:00
|
|
|
{ stdenv, fetchurl, glib, pkgconfig, intltool, gnutls, libgcrypt
|
2012-01-06 19:12:38 +01:00
|
|
|
, gsettings_desktop_schemas }:
|
|
|
|
|
2012-01-06 19:13:26 +01:00
|
|
|
stdenv.mkDerivation {
|
2012-01-06 19:12:38 +01:00
|
|
|
name = "glib-networking-2.30.2";
|
|
|
|
|
|
|
|
src = fetchurl {
|
|
|
|
url = mirror://gnome/sources/glib-networking/2.30/glib-networking-2.30.2.tar.xz;
|
|
|
|
sha256 = "1g2ran0rn37009fs3xl38m95i5w8sdf9ax0ady4jbjir15844xcz";
|
|
|
|
};
|
|
|
|
|
|
|
|
propagatedBuildInputs = [ glib gnutls libgcrypt ];
|
|
|
|
buildInputs = [ gsettings_desktop_schemas ];
|
2012-01-18 21:53:01 +01:00
|
|
|
buildNativeInputs = [ pkgconfig intltool ];
|
2012-01-06 19:12:38 +01:00
|
|
|
|
|
|
|
configureFlags = "--without-ca-certificates";
|
|
|
|
postConfigure = "export makeFlags=GIO_MODULE_DIR=$out/${glib.gioModuleDir}";
|
|
|
|
|
|
|
|
meta = {
|
|
|
|
TODO = "Look at `--without-ca-certificates` again";
|
2012-01-06 19:54:02 +01:00
|
|
|
inherit (glib.meta) platforms maintainers;
|
2012-01-06 19:12:38 +01:00
|
|
|
};
|
|
|
|
}
|